Understanding Clinical Psychology
Clinical psychology focuses on diagnosing and treating mental, emotional, and behavioral disorders.
It combines science and practice to improve mental health outcomes.
Core Areas of Clinical Psychology
- Psychological assessment
- Diagnosis of mental disorders
- Therapy and counseling
- Behavioral interventions
